"Salvia divinorum is a psychoactive herb which can induce strong dissociative effects."

A link to an overview of it's legal status

A responsible gardener will always check to see if a plant they are unfamiliar with is suitable for their locality. But not everyone is so inclined and as far as I know, you are the first to make a general offering here of plants illegal in many parts of the country. So it wouldn't be surprising for a trusting soul to fall for your offer, thinking they are getting just another variety of salvia for their garden.

It is irresponsible to offer any plants here that might cause an unsuspecting person to face a felony charge without at least offering a warning that possesing what you want to trade is illegal in many states, regulated in others and is being considered for inclusion in controlled substance lists in still others.

Are you offering any other things on your list that might get an unsuspecting person into legal difficulties? Are you shipping these plants into states where its possession is criminalized or regulated? (Not that I care a whit, but you might face felony charges yourself.)

Not all of the plants offered will get you high, but this person seems to have a strong interest in those that will. Here's some notes on a few of the offerings:

Ololuiqui seeds "can transport the user on a legal LSD-like trip for about six hours. To prepare a dose, users soak about fifteen crushed seeds in V2 cup of water and drink the resulting mixture." (It also a member of the bindweed family and can be invasive.)

Virola bark resin contains hallucinogenic alkaloids. "It is a powerful and instantaneous hallucinogen."

Trichocereus peruvianus (Peruvian Torch cactus) "contains a number of psychoactive alkaloids, in particular the well-studied chemical mescaline .... although not as high as Lophophora williamsii (Peyote)." If you don't use it all to get high, you can use it to treat dandruff.

Yopo produces a psychoactive substance that will provide a trip of up to several hours.

Hawaiian Baby Woodrose: The seeds of the plant can be consumed to produce psychedelic effects. Being related to morning glory and bindweed, watch for invasiveness.

As I read somewhere on the web: WARNING: DO NOT INGEST ANY BOTANICAL WHICH YOU HAVE NOT FULLY RESEARCHED AND CORRECTLY IDENTIFIED!!!
